Overview -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 vs BMW K 1300 GT 2009

The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 and the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 are both touring motorcycles designed for long-distance rides. While they share some similarities in terms of engine type, front and rear tire diameter, seat height, and fuel tank capacity, there are notable differences between the two models.

In terms of engine performance, the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 has a more powerful engine compared to the Honda NT1100 DCT 2022. The BMW boasts an inline engine with 160 HP and 135 Nm of torque, while the Honda features an inline engine with 102 HP and 104 Nm of torque. This gives the BMW a significant advantage in terms of power and acceleration.

When it comes to transmission, the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 utilizes a chain drive system, while the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 employs a prop shaft drive system. Both systems have their pros and cons, with the chain drive offering better efficiency and easier maintenance, while the prop shaft drive provides smoother power delivery and less maintenance.

In terms of suspension, the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 features an upside-down telescopic fork at the front and a swing arm suspension at the rear. On the other hand, the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 is equipped with a strut front suspension and a paralever rear suspension. While both setups provide adequate comfort and stability, the BMW's paralever suspension offers better handling and stability in corners.

Both motorcycles feature double disk brakes at the front, ensuring reliable stopping power. The dimensions and weights of the two models are also similar, with 17-inch front and rear tire diameters, a wheelbase of around 1500 mm, and a seat height of 820 mm. However, the BMW has a larger fuel tank capacity of 24 liters compared to the Honda's 20.4 liters, allowing for longer rides without refueling.

In terms of strengths, the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 stands out with its extensive standard equipment, perfect wind and weather protection, great engine performance, and comfort. It also offers Apple Carplay and Android Auto integration, allowing riders to easily connect their smartphones. Additionally, the suspension setup of the Honda is well-coordinated, providing a smooth and enjoyable ride.

On the other hand, the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 offers a relaxed riding feel, confident turn-in behavior, and a strong engine with plenty of power. Its efficient windshield provides excellent wind protection, enhancing rider comfort during long rides.

However, both motorcycles have their weaknesses. The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 lacks an Inertial Measurement Unit (IMU), which can affect its stability and handling in certain situations. It also has limited color options and does not offer an option for an e-chassis. On the other hand, the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 has handling disadvantages in bends, which may affect its maneuverability in tight corners.

In conclusion, while the Honda NT1100 DCT 2022 and the BMW K 1300 GT 2009 are both touring motorcycles suitable for long-distance rides, they have distinct differences in terms of engine power, transmission, suspension, and strengths and weaknesses. Riders should consider their specific preferences and priorities when choosing between the two models.

The NT1100 has the potential to be a big hit in the travel segment. Honda has done its homework brilliantly in many areas. The final consistency on the subject of safety features prevents an even better rating of the tourer. Nevertheless, it is one of the best touring motorbikes I have ever ridden. A little courage for additional equipment variants and more colour could bring the NT 2023 right to the front.

The engine now produces 160 hp and 135 Nm. This should make further comments on driving performance superfluous. Sitting upright with the windshield extended, you can accelerate to over 250 km/h with absolute ease. Only at this point do you start to think a little about the poor engine - below this, it is simply completely underpowered, always and everywhere.
